Sacré-Cœur, Paris – Forgotten Postcard

Paris, France has such an iconic skyline, it’s hard to create a piece of art that is original and does the scene justice. I hope this Forgotten Postcard is a step in that direction. The view is Sacré-Cœur, and Montmartre as seen from the roof of the Pompidou Modern Art Gallery.
